Tumbler Tomato Small Fruited

Tumbler Tomato
Grower Information

Common Name: Small-Fruited, Cherry
Hardiness Degree: 40°F (4.4°C)
Plant Habit: Mounded, Trailing
Characteristics: Attracts Bees, Heat Tolerant, Low Maintenance
Water: Medium
Fertilize: Once a week
Height: 12 - 18" (30 - 46cm)
Width: 36 - 60" (91 - 152cm)
Exposure: Sun
General Information: Bite-size tomatoes have a sweet flavor for fresh eating.
Try them sautéed and served over pasta, too!

Idea & Tips: Graceful, cascading plant makes this the best tomato for hanging baskets and planters. Plant in well-drained soil in full sun. Water when dry.
Growth: Determinate
Days to Harvest: 49
Fruit Size: 1.25 in. (3 cm)
Grower Information: The best tomato for hanging baskets and containers, Tumbler has a graceful, cascading habit. The very productive, extra-early plants produce up to 6 lbs. (2.7 kg) of sweet cherry-type tomatoes, 1.25 in. (3 cm) in diameter.
